You can use designfilt and other algorithm-specific ( butter, fir1) functions when … A high-pass filter (HPF) is an electronic filter that passes signals with a frequency higher than a certain cutoff frequency and attenuates signals with frequencies lower than the cutoff frequency. The amount of attenuation for each frequency depends on the filter design. A high-pass filter is usually modeled as a linear time-invariant system. It is sometimes called a low-cut filter or bass-cut filter in the …

You can switch between continuous and discrete implementations of the integrator using the Sample time parameter. how hip hop is used to teach childrenWebFeb 3, 2015 · If the two poles of the filter are not close together, the 2nd order canonical terms like the natural frequency and the damping factor start to loose practical meaning. If the poles are close together, the natural frequency will tend to be near the -3dB frequency but not exactly. The equation you keep seeing is for the natural frequency. how hips work in golf swingWebJan 13, 2024 · The transfer function of ideal high pass filter is as shown in the equation below: The frequency response characteristics of an ideal high pass filter is as shown in below figure.
